56 minutes ago, HuntingFever said:

Which section of that playthrough is RNG based?

I went into the details more in that section of the trophy guide, but the short version is a certain scouting location can appear anywhere between 3-5 stops from your city. If it doesn't appear on stop #3, getting everyone fed before they starve is very difficult.

 

In the rest, RNG shouldn't play too big a part if you have a solid strategy.

6 hours ago, HuntingFever said:

Thank you for the info :). BTW, is it a good idea to have the DLCs installed from the get-go or should they bought much later on?

It doesn't really matter. They don't affect the main scenarios at all - TLA and OTE are their own scenarios, and Rifts is an endless mode map. They can affect your Ultramarathon playthrough, but only if you choose those options. (The Rifts map is more complex, so I wouldn't recommend it for an already difficult playthrough. OTE lets you toggle settlements in endless mode, at the cost of also enabling random hazards. Some people say the trade-off is worth it, some don't. I got the Ultramarathon trophies before DLC came to console, so it's definitely possible to do without.)
